What are the typical daily responsibilities of an Apple Map Driver?

Apple Map Drivers are responsible for operating a company vehicle along predetermined routes, collecting and verifying geographic and imagery data using specialized equipment. On a typical day, you will monitor and log information about roads, landmarks, and changes in the environment, ensuring all data is accurately captured according to company guidelines. The role requires independent work, but you may collaborate with mapping technicians, supervisors, and support staff to troubleshoot equipment or clarify data requirements. Drivers also maintain regular vehicle and equipment checks to ensure everything is functioning properly and in compliance with safety standards. This position is ideal for individuals who enjoy working autonomously while contributing to the accuracy of digital maps used by millions.

What is an Apple Map Driver job?

An Apple Map Driver is responsible for driving designated routes while collecting detailed mapping data for Apple Maps. Drivers operate specialized vehicles equipped with cameras and sensors to capture street-level imagery and geographic information. The data collected helps improve Apple Maps' accuracy, navigation, and features. This role requires a valid driver's license, attention to detail, and the ability to follow assigned routes efficiently. It may involve long hours of driving and adherence to strict data collection protocols.

Medical Records and Transportation Job Overview

The Medical Records and Transportation is a dual role position that requires someone who is detail-oriented. The position reports directly to the Administrator and require managing the integrity, confidentiality, and accessibility of resident health records while also serving as a vital link to the community by transporting residents to and from outside medical appointments.

Medical Records and Transportation Job Responsibilities

Medical Records:

Maintain resident medical records in accordance with federal and state regulations (HIPAA, CMS) and facility policies.

Perform regular audits of thin charts and electronic health records (EHR) to ensure completeness, accuracy, and timely physician signatures.

Process new resident records and ensure discharge files are closed, indexed, and stored securely.

Manage all requests for medical records from legal entities, families, and other healthcare providers.

Maintain the medical records room and digital filing systems to ensure quick retrieval for state surveys or clinical needs.

Transportation:

Safely transport residents to and from scheduled doctors' appointments, dialysis, or specialized clinics using the facility vehicle.

Coordinate with the nursing department and external clinics to manage the weekly transport calendar.

Assist residents in and out of the vehicle (including wheelchair lift operation) and ensure they are safely checked into their appointments.

Act as a liaison, ensuring any paperwork or instructions from the outside physician are delivered back to the facility’s clinical team.
